.project-page[data-astro-cid-tlgdlkhg]{padding:40px 0 100px;--accent-rgb: 168, 85, 247}.back-link[data-astro-cid-tlgdlkhg]{display:inline-flex;align-items:center;gap:8px;color:var(--text-secondary);font-size:14px;margin-bottom:24px;text-decoration:none;transition:color .3s}.back-link[data-astro-cid-tlgdlkhg]:hover{color:hsl(var(--accent-primary))}.project-header[data-astro-cid-tlgdlkhg]{margin-bottom:48px}.project-title-row[data-astro-cid-tlgdlkhg]{display:flex;align-items:center;gap:20px;margin-bottom:16px}.project-icon[data-astro-cid-tlgdlkhg]{font-size:64px}.project-title[data-astro-cid-tlgdlkhg]{font-size:clamp(40px,8vw,64px);font-weight:700}.project-meta[data-astro-cid-tlgdlkhg]{display:flex;gap:12px;flex-wrap:wrap;align-items:center}.status-badge[data-astro-cid-tlgdlkhg]{padding:6px 16px;border-radius:100px;font-size:12px;font-weight:600;text-transform:uppercase}.status-wip[data-astro-cid-tlgdlkhg]{background:#fb923c26;color:#fb923c;border:1px solid rgba(251,146,60,.35)}.tech-tag[data-astro-cid-tlgdlkhg]{padding:6px 14px;background:hsla(var(--accent-primary),.1);border:1px solid hsla(var(--accent-primary),.25);border-radius:100px;font-size:13px;color:hsl(var(--accent-primary))}.project-content[data-astro-cid-tlgdlkhg]{display:flex;flex-direction:column;gap:40px}.hero-card[data-astro-cid-tlgdlkhg]{display:grid;grid-template-columns:1fr 1fr;gap:40px;background:linear-gradient(135deg,hsla(var(--accent-primary),.08),#ffffff05);border:1px solid hsla(var(--accent-primary),.2);border-radius:28px;padding:52px;align-items:center}.hero-title[data-astro-cid-tlgdlkhg]{font-size:clamp(28px,4vw,42px);font-weight:900;color:hsl(var(--accent-primary));margin-bottom:12px}.hero-sub[data-astro-cid-tlgdlkhg]{font-size:18px;font-weight:700;color:var(--text-primary);margin-bottom:16px;line-height:1.3}.hero-desc[data-astro-cid-tlgdlkhg]{color:var(--text-secondary);font-size:16px;line-height:1.7;margin-bottom:28px}.cta-row[data-astro-cid-tlgdlkhg]{display:flex;gap:12px}.btn-primary[data-astro-cid-tlgdlkhg]{display:inline-flex;align-items:center;padding:12px 28px;background:var(--btn-bg, hsl(var(--accent-primary)));color:var(--btn-text, #fff);border-radius:100px;font-size:14px;font-weight:600;text-decoration:none;transition:all .3s;border:none}.btn-primary[data-astro-cid-tlgdlkhg]:hover{transform:translateY(-2px);filter:brightness(1.1);color:var(--btn-text, #fff)}.hero-terminal[data-astro-cid-tlgdlkhg]{background:#1e1e2e;border-radius:14px;border:1px solid #313244;box-shadow:0 30px 60px #00000080;overflow:hidden;font-family:JetBrains Mono,Fira Code,monospace}.term-header[data-astro-cid-tlgdlkhg]{background:#181825;padding:12px 16px;display:flex;align-items:center;gap:8px;border-bottom:1px solid #313244}.dot[data-astro-cid-tlgdlkhg]{width:10px;height:10px;border-radius:50%}.dot[data-astro-cid-tlgdlkhg].red{background:#f38ba8}.dot[data-astro-cid-tlgdlkhg].yellow{background:#f9e2af}.dot[data-astro-cid-tlgdlkhg].green{background:#a6e3a1}.term-title[data-astro-cid-tlgdlkhg]{font-size:11px;color:#cdd6f4;opacity:.7;margin-left:auto}.term-body[data-astro-cid-tlgdlkhg]{padding:20px;font-size:13px;line-height:1.9;color:#cdd6f4}.prompt[data-astro-cid-tlgdlkhg]{color:#89b4fa;font-weight:700;margin-right:8px}.thinking[data-astro-cid-tlgdlkhg]{color:#94e2d5;font-style:italic;margin-right:8px}.tool[data-astro-cid-tlgdlkhg]{color:#f9e2af;font-weight:700;margin-right:8px}.success[data-astro-cid-tlgdlkhg]{color:#a6e3a1;font-weight:700;margin-right:8px}.section-block[data-astro-cid-tlgdlkhg]{background:var(--bg-card);border:1px solid var(--border);border-radius:20px;padding:36px}.section-block[data-astro-cid-tlgdlkhg] h2[data-astro-cid-tlgdlkhg]{font-size:22px;font-weight:700;margin-bottom:16px;padding-bottom:14px;border-bottom:1px solid hsla(var(--accent-primary),.2);color:hsl(var(--accent-primary))}.section-block[data-astro-cid-tlgdlkhg] p[data-astro-cid-tlgdlkhg]{color:var(--text-secondary);line-height:1.8;font-size:16px}.features-grid[data-astro-cid-tlgdlkhg]{display:grid;grid-template-columns:repeat(3,1fr);gap:18px}.feature-card[data-astro-cid-tlgdlkhg]{padding:28px;background:#ffffff05;border:1px solid var(--border);border-radius:18px;transition:all .3s}.feature-card[data-astro-cid-tlgdlkhg]:hover{border-color:hsl(var(--accent-primary));transform:translateY(-4px);background:hsla(var(--accent-primary),.05)}.f-icon[data-astro-cid-tlgdlkhg]{font-size:30px;display:block;margin-bottom:16px}.feature-card[data-astro-cid-tlgdlkhg] h3[data-astro-cid-tlgdlkhg]{font-size:16px;font-weight:700;margin-bottom:10px}.feature-card[data-astro-cid-tlgdlkhg] p[data-astro-cid-tlgdlkhg]{font-size:13px;color:var(--text-secondary);line-height:1.55}@media(max-width:960px){.hero-card[data-astro-cid-tlgdlkhg]{grid-template-columns:1fr}}@media(max-width:768px){.features-grid[data-astro-cid-tlgdlkhg]{grid-template-columns:repeat(2,1fr)}}@media(max-width:500px){.features-grid[data-astro-cid-tlgdlkhg]{grid-template-columns:1fr}}
